University Overview

Established in 1939, Caldwell University is a non-profit private higher-education institution located in the suburban setting of the medium town of Caldwell (population range of 2,500-9,999 inhabitants), New Jersey. Officially accredited by the Middle States Commission on Higher Education, Caldwell University is a small (uniRank enrollment range: 2,000-2,999 students) coeducational US higher education institution formally affiliated with the Christian-Catholic religion. Caldwell University offers courses and programs leading to officially recognized higher education degrees such as bachelor degrees, master degrees, doctorate degrees in several areas of study. This 83 years old US higher-education institution has a selective admission policy based on entrance examinations and students' past academic record and grades. The admission rate range is 60-70% making this US higher education organization a somewhat selective institution. International applicants are eligible to apply for enrollment. Caldwell University also provides several academic and non-academic facilities and services to students including a library, housing, sports facilities, financial aids and/or scholarships, study abroad and exchange programs, online courses and distance learning opportunities, as well as administrative services.

Facilities and Services

Library Yes Go to Caldwell University's Library
Caldwell University's library collection is comprised of both physical (i.e. books, medium etc.) and digital/electronic items. In 2018 the library has reported 142,662 physical volumes, 2,020 physical media, 238,830 digital/electronic medium and 66 licensed digital/electronic databases.
Housing Yes
Caldwell University provides on-campus housing. The total dormitory capacity, whether on or off campus, was about 611 students in the 2018 academic year.
